Bronco and Blazer Started Here
This 1975 Scout II represents the second-generation of the International Scout family. Without the first Scout in 1961, there would be no 1966 Ford Bronco or 1969 Chevy Blazer. But is this second-generation Scout II a copy of Bronco and Blazer? Did the Scout eat its own tail? Watch and learn!
